School of Management & Entrepreneurship Admission 2026

Eligibility Criteria and Selection Process

Admission to the flagship MBA and MBA-Technology programs offered by the School of Management and Entrepreneurship (SME) is based on the following eligibility requirements and selection stages:

Note:

  • Note 1: In the first year, students complete core courses across multiple disciplines. In the second year, they may choose between the MBA or MBA-Technology track.

  • Note 2: Students who complete their first year at SME, IIT Jodhpur, may opt to pursue their second year at a partner B-school abroad (SUNY Albany, Brandeis International Business School, George Washington University, Case Western Reserve University), leading to an International Dual Degree.

1. Eligibility Criteria

A. Academic Qualification

  • Applicants must hold a Bachelor’s degree or an equivalent qualification awarded by a recognized university/institution (as per UGC/legislative guidelines).

  • The degree must include at least three years of education after 10+2 or equivalent.

Note:

Final-year students may apply. If selected, they will be admitted provisionally and must:

  • Submit all academic records up to the latest completed semester/year.

  • Provide a provisional degree certificate within two months of joining.

    Failure to meet these conditions will lead to cancellation of admission.

B. Minimum Marks Requirement

For General/OBC/EWS applicants:

  • 60% aggregate marks, OR

  • 6.0 CGPA on a 10-point scale.

Relaxations for SC/ST/PwD:

  • 5% relaxation in marks (for the 60% criterion), OR

  • 0.5 relaxation (for the 6.0 CGPA criterion).

    These relaxations apply only for eligibility.

C. Entrance Exam Requirement

  • A valid CAT 2025 score is mandatory.

2. Admission Process

A. Initial Shortlisting

Candidates are shortlisted using a composite score based on:

  • CAT Overall Scaled Score

  • Full-time Work Experience

  • Gender Diversity

Important Notes:

  • CAT cut-offs (overall and/or sectional) may be applied depending on application volume.

  • The following types of work experience will NOT be considered:

    • Coaching centres, self-run or small-scale businesses (retail shops, Kirana stores, NGOs, petrol pumps, etc.)

    • Internships, apprenticeships, or unpaid work

  • Work experience must be supported by experience letters and first & last salary slips.

  • Experience is counted only if ≥ 15 days per month (less than 15 days will not be considered).

  • The cut-off date for calculating experience is the application start date.

  • The institute holds full discretion regarding the validity of work experience.

B. Final Shortlisting

Shortlisted candidates will be called for a Personal Interview (virtual mode).

The final selection will be based on:

  • Composite Score

  • Personal Interview Performance

Relaxations for reserved categories will be applied as per Ministry of Education guidelines.

3. Eligibility & Process for International Applicants

A. Eligibility

  • Same as points 1A and 1B above.

  • Degree equivalence may be verified through the Association of Indian Universities (AIU).

B. Selection

  • Admission is merit-based.

  • Candidates must have:

    • GRE score of 300+, or

    • GMAT score of 600+,

      obtained within the last 5 years.

4. Applicants Applying While Employed

Candidates on study leave/sabbatical/higher study leave must submit a No Objection Certificate (NOC) from their employer.

The NOC must:

  • Either permit the candidate to participate in external internships/placements, OR

  • Specify that the internship must be completed only with the current employer, and that the candidate must return after completing the program.
